WebFirstly, gerbils are not nocturnal and are instead most active at dawn and dusk like cats. Gerbils will poop and pee a lot; however, my experience is that they prefer to do so in specific areas of their cage. So if you have them out with access to their cage, they will run back in and use the bathroom there more often than not.
